Evaluating Streamer Engagement and Reach
Evaluating streamer engagement and reach is critical for effective marketing strategies. Brands should analyzd metrics such as average viewership and chat activity. These metrics provide insights into how actively viewers interact with the streamer. High engagement rates often indicate a loyal audience.
Additionally, assessing the streamer’s follower count is essential. However, sheer numbers can be misleading without engagement context. A smaller channel with high interaction may yield better results than a larger, less engaged one. Brands must also consider the streamer’s content alignment with their products. This alignment enhances the authenticity of the promotion.
Furthermore, analyzing past campaign performances can provide valuable insights. Successful collaborations often reflect the streamer’s ability to drive conversions. Understanding these dynamics is vital for optimizing marketing efforts. Engaging with the right streamers can lead to significant returns.

Legal and Ethical Considerations
Legal and ethical considerations are paramount in influencer marketing. Brands must ensure compliance with advertising regulations, such as the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) guidelines. These regulations require clear disclosure of paid partnerships.
Additionally, brands should be aware of intellectual property rights. Using copyrighted material without permission can lead to legal repercussions. Influencers must also respect the privacy of their audience. This respect fosters a positive brand image.
Moreover, ethical considerations include promoting products responsibly. Brands should avoid misleading claims about efficacy. This approach protects consumers and enhances credibility. Engaging in ethical marketing practices is essential for long-term success.
